We are a community-driven organisation extending a helping hand to those in need in West Africa. Our mission is to provide support to individuals of all ages and genders starting with the establishment of a primary school for children. With our school successfully operational for four years, We are now building a skill centre which will offer free classes to help teach income generating skills.

Charitable objects
THE ADVANCEMENT OF EDUCATION & THE RELIEF OF POVERTY IN GHANA IN SUCH MANNER AS THE TRUSTEES SHALL IN THEIR DISCRETION DETERMINE AND IN PARTICULAR BY PROVIDING FINANCIAL SUPPORT, FACILITIES IMPROVEMENTS AND TUTORING & MENTORING TO SCHOOLS IN AREAS OF POVERTY IN GHANA.
